若要將現有的鏈作為另一個鏈的一部分執行,請新增Run Chain 事件。使用此事件,您可以獨立使用連鎖或在其他連鎖中使用模組化元件。當您以Run Chain 事件執行連鎖時,您可以在父連鎖中的較後指令使用其輸出。
註記: 如果在連鎖中包含多個Run Chain 事件,且需要在連鎖之間傳遞變數,請使用Runtime Input 觸發事件啟動較後的連鎖。
步驟 1.將事件加入連鎖
- 在Chain Builder 中,從Chains 索引標籤,按一下Edit 。
- 按一下Chain Events ,並將Run Chain 移至事件在連鎖中應該出現的位置。
- 從事件的前一個節點拖曳連結至事件。
步驟 2.設定連鎖執行
- 選取事件的節點,然後按一下「編輯」(Edit) create。
- 在「基本資訊」(Basic Info) 下,輸入唯一的名稱和描述以識別事件。
- 若要在其他鏈中重複執行鏈,請啟用迭代 ,並設定迭代器 。
- 選擇要執行的鏈。
步驟 3.添加跳過條件(如有必要)
若要根據分支邏輯執行連鎖,您可以設定跳過條件,並自動回傳特定結果。
- 在Skip 下 ,選擇跳過事件鏈時是否自動返回 info, warning, 或 error 的結果。
注意:warning 狀態不會停止進行中的連鎖,任何下游節點仍會執行。
- 若要指定何時跳過事件,請將條件邏輯建立為一個群組,並將規則和其他規則群組加入其中,每個群組都以 AND 或 OR 結合。
- 如果必須滿足所有條件才能略過,請選擇 AND。
- 如果只有一個 條件必須為真,請選擇或 。
若要驗證資料是否符合命令的略過規則,請將其與運算符號和值配對:資料類型 說明 字串 兩個或更多字元 整數 任何整數、無小數點的數值 日期 任何日期字串或日期變數 浮點 任何數值 JSON JavaScript 物件表示法;使用變數轉換來解析物件 - Is blank 或 Is not blank
包含- Matches RegExp,用於正則運算式
- Starts with 或 Ends with
-
=or!= -
<或> -
<=or>=
- 按一下「儲存」(Save)。
備註: 在您將父鏈推廣到另一個環境之前,請確保事件執行的鏈存在於該環境中。
檢視執行鏈
當運行鏈事件包含在父鏈中時,您可以透過Monitor 畫面快速存取子鏈。
方法如下
- 在鏈結產生器中,按一下「監控 。
- 選擇您要檢視的連鎖執行。
- 按一下連鎖圖中的Run Chain 節點。由該節點執行的鏈會出現在右側的結果面板中。
- 在右側的結果面板中,使用鍵盤和滑鼠調整子鏈的檢視:
- 拖曳畫布 :在任何空白處按住滑鼠以拖曳畫布。
- 縮放 :按住CTRL 鍵,然後用滑鼠滾輪捲動以放大或縮小。
- 連按兩下子鏈的任何節點,以在新的瀏覽器索引標籤中開啟。然後,您可以編輯、執行並檢視與原始碼鏈分離的次要鏈。